No traffic touring cycling routes around gmina Borowa are characterized by a predominantly flat landscape within the Sandomierz Basin, making them suitable for accessible cycling. The region is situated at the confluence of the Vistula and Wisłoka rivers, featuring riverine environments and minor elevation changes. Touring cyclists can expect to traverse agricultural areas and rural scenery. This geographical setting provides a network of routes with gentle gradients.

There are 177 no-traffic touring cycling routes available in gmina Borowa. The majority of these, 108, are rated as easy, making the area very accessible for relaxed rides. Another 63 routes are moderate, and 6 are more challenging.
Gmina Borowa is situated within the Sandomierz Basin, characterized by a predominantly flat landscape with minimal elevation changes. This makes it ideal for leisurely touring cycling. Most routes are easy, with gentle gradients, perfect for various fitness levels. For example, the Bike loop from gmina Borowa covers 12.5 km with only 10 meters of elevation gain.

The routes in gmina Borowa traverse a picturesque agricultural landscape, passing through farmlands and local villages. You'll also experience the unique riverine environments of the Vistula and Wisłoka rivers, often cycling along waterways and through riparian zones. The flat terrain of the Sandomierz Basin provides expansive views of the rural scenery.
While cycling, you can discover several points of interest. Consider visiting the historic St. Adalbert Church in Gawłuszowice. You might also pass by the Memorial to the Cursed Soldiers or see the impressive Railway Bridge over the Vistula. For a meal, Restauracja Manuka is a local option.

The best time to enjoy touring cycling in gmina Borowa is typically during the spring, summer, and early autumn months. These seasons offer pleasant weather conditions, allowing you to fully appreciate the rural landscapes and riverine scenery. The flat terrain is generally accessible even after light rain, but dry conditions are always preferable.
While gmina Borowa itself offers many local routes, its location provides access to broader regional cycling opportunities. The Subcarpathian Voivodeship is part of the Green Velo East of Poland Cycling Trail, and the Vistula Cycling Route (WTR) also has sections nearby. These networks offer potential for extended, predominantly flat, and scenic long-distance touring.
Given the agricultural and riverine nature of the region, you can expect a mix of surface types. Many routes will likely feature paved roads through villages and along river embankments, as well as well-maintained gravel or compacted earth paths through farmlands. The flat terrain ensures these surfaces are generally easy to navigate for touring bikes.
